Aspreva Pharmaceuticals Corporation Announces Preliminary Revenues For First Quarter 2006 And Revises Guidance

VICTORIA, BC, April 13 /PRNewswire-FirstCall/ - Aspreva Pharmaceuticals Corporation , an emerging pharmaceutical company focused on increasing the pool of evidence-based medicines for patients with less common diseases, today announced preliminary revenues of approximately US$62 million for the first quarter of 2006.

First quarter 2006 revenues include a higher than expected quarterly reconciliation payment of US$16 million related to the third quarter of 2005. The receipt of this reconciliation payment is in compliance with the terms of Aspreva's collaboration agreement with Roche. Aspreva anticipates royalty revenues for the full year 2006 to be in excess of US$200 million, including the higher reconciliation payment in the first quarter.

About Aspreva Pharmaceuticals

Aspreva is an emerging pharmaceutical company focused on identifying, developing and, upon regulatory approval, commercializing new indications for approved drugs and drug candidates for patients living with less common diseases. Aspreva's "Indication Partnering" strategy allows its partners to maintain core brand focus while extending the benefits of their medicines to a broader patient population.
